bottom of the ninth
idiomBy extension, any last chance or final opportunity.

bet one's bottom dollar
To be absolutely sure of something; to be certain enough of something to wager everything.
- 02
bottom dollar
The last of one's money; all of one's money.
- 03
bottom fishing
Buying, or seeking opportunities to buy, investment securities or other valuable properties at a time when markets are depressed and prices are low.
- 04
bottom line
The summary or result; the most important information.
- 05
bottom of the line
The worst or lowest quality on the market, especially among a range of products.
- 06
bottom out
Of a vehicle, to touch or drag along the ground or other surface.
- 07
bottom the house
To clean a house from top to bottom; to clean a house extremely thoroughly.
- 08
get to the bottom of
To come to understand, discover the truth about, or solve.
